Phishing Scams

Phishing scams have become alarmingly prevalent, particularly in the digital gambling space. Scammers often send emails or messages that appear to come from legitimate casinos, asking players to verify their accounts or reset their passwords. These messages typically contain links that lead to fake websites designed to capture sensitive information, such as credit card details and personal identification.

To avoid falling victim to such scams, always verify the sender’s email address and refrain from clicking on links in unsolicited messages. It is safer to visit the casino’s website directly by typing the URL into your browser.

Social Engineering and Impersonation

The human element of casino scams cannot be overlooked. Scammers often use social engineering techniques to gain the trust of their victims. This can include impersonating customer support representatives or other casino staff to extract information or money from players.

Protecting Yourself

To safeguard against such tactics, it is essential for players to verify the identity of anyone claiming to represent the casino. Use official channels to communicate with the casino, and avoid sharing personal information over the phone or via email, especially if prompted unexpectedly.
